For the Quillforge build farm, our dependency pinning policy directly affects cache sizing. Fully pinned lockfiles mean each service variant gets its own resolver cache entry, so looser pins reduce storage but increase rebuild churn. Based on last quarter's numbers from the Delvaux cluster, we're standardizing on exact pins for runtime deps and minor-range pins for tooling. Please review the resolver settings with that tradeoff in mind, since they cap cache growth. The tuning constants we propose for the next cycle follow.

tuning constants:
QUOTAS = {
    "druwyn": 5,
    "holix": 5,
    "zorath": 5,
    "holwyn": 10,
}

# Client setup for the Vramscope profiling service.
# Vramscope collects GPU memory snapshots from build agents and
# aggregates them per release candidate. The release manager should
# verify that peak allocation stays under the budget defined in
# thresholds.yaml before sign-off. The client authenticates against
# the internal Vramscope API using the key configured below.

app token of yajeg-kawef = kto11_7En3XSX8xQw

### Changelog — Keyfall v2.8 (for eng sync)

Renamed setting as part of the password reset flow revamp: `RESET_MAILER_KEY` is now `KEYFALL_RESET_TOKEN`. The old name stops working after this release, so update every environment file before deploying. Reset links now expire in 15 minutes instead of 60. The renamed credential should be set on the line that follows.

env line for fafof-fahag: LEDGER_TOKEN5=f8790